All .a libraries were converted to .la, and instead of linking the
Xorg binary with a mix of .a and .la, and adding some libraries more
then once in the command line, etc, now it generates a single libxorg.la
from all the required convenience libraries, and links with a dummy
xorg.c (that should usually be the file with the main function...).
This removes the requirement of some things like libosandcommon and
libinit, that existed to circumvent problems when linking multiple
.a and .la in the final Xorg binary.
The "symbol table" is now generated dynamically, by a shell script,
with an embedded gawk parser that parses cpp output. The new file
sdksyms.sh is generated by hand by analyzing all Makefile.am's and
making it create a sdksyms.c file, that includes all sdk headers that
will add symbols for the Xorg binary. Module headers aren't read, and
a in 2 files it was required to add a "<hash>ifndef XorgLoader" around
declarations shared between the Xorg binary and libextmod. A few
other changes were added to other sdk headers, like preventing
multiple inclusion, or including other headers to satisfy dependencies.
This should be a lot more portable, and better (hopefully properly)
using libtool to generate convenience libraries.

Fix and marginally simplify the SHA1 handling. First, we allow people
to override it. Secondly, we try for libmd. Then, we try for OpenSSL
with pkg-config. In a last, desperate move, we try libcrypto on its
own. This allows the server to, y'know, _link_ when using OpenSSL,
instead of failing because we only have -lcrypto, and not -lssl.
Previously, the code was using PKG_CHECK_EXISTS before PKG_CHECK_MODULES,
(to cater to OpenBSD systems that include openssl by default but without
a .pc file). But this meant that systems that didn't have openssl installed
at all would not get any error message at configure time.
Now, if the SHA1_Init function is found in -lcrypto without any additional
flags, then that's used. Otherwise, pkg-config is used to find the right
flags to link against libcrypto. And if that fails, a nice error message
is now generated.

This copies over the files generated from mesa/src/mesa/glapi. There's
a corresponding mesa commit that makes it easy to generate the glapi files
straight into the xserver tree when the XML definitions change.
The only few files that are copied from mesa but aren't generated are
glapi.[ch] and glthread.[ch]. Everything in there is technically DRI
driver API and the whole setup is still a bit fragile, but it's not a new
problem.
The --with-mesa-source configure option is still around since other
parts of the server (XGL and DMX - grep for MESA_SOURCE) need that,
but for common case of building with GLX and AIGLX support, that
option is no longer needed.
